Hello to everyone who got to meet Pablo. Pablo recently passed away at fifteen years young. He was never a senior dog, rather he was still rocking it like Mike Jagger at his age. He crossed to the Sky World. at home in Italy, painless and in a peaceful setting. The Sky World is filled with love, big juicy steaks, and many four-legged ladies, so Pablo should feel right at home there. Please kindly, give a heartfelt goodbye to Pablo. I'm sure he'll hear you and sn**ch the sandwich off of your table as he did many times before at the Bourgeois Pig.

ABOUT PABLO
To put it plainly, Pablo was more himself than any person could ever be; he loved and was loved. He fell in love with you before you did. Despite my advice to never talk to strangers, drunk people, and Trump he had a great deal of faith in other people. Unfortunately, he had a stroke last year that left him paralyzed, so it wasn't the best year of his life, but he miraculously somehow recovered from the death. Being stubborn might sometimes help you get by in life. Pablo was a stubborn dog that always claimed his way of life. And since I constantly reminded him that he is a free spirit with the freedom to do as he pleases, I allowed him to do that. For this reason, I had to pick him up from the police station next to the Bourgeois Pig a few times when he ran off to enjoy himself more. Stealing bits of Kebab at the I.P. Pavlova Square. Nevertheless, he was an incredibly kind, loving, and beautiful spirit who had no desire to hurt anyone. He already knew that When the Saints go marching in we will carry war no more. (Tears for Fears) He had a long, fulfilling life filled with love, passion, and freedom living in New York, Bratislava, Prague, and Italy. Perhaps this explains why Cosmopolitan was his favorite beverage to lick. However, I think his most happy years were spent as the most amazing hostess ever at THE BOURGEOUS PIG.

Pablo taught me one of the most valuable life lessons, even though there are countless stories about him. For instance, he once broke an expensive glass vase at the art gallery, costing three thousand euros. Pablo was, to state it clearly, an expensive dog. Yes, there were a lot of other times when I would kill him without thinking twice. Pablo had more encounters with Czech and Slovak celebrities than any other dog in history, probably holding the honor of having been close to Madonna. We used to live in New York, just next door to the Madonna's home. Pablo was once a model who would patiently sit through numerous fashion magazine photo shoots. He eventually ended up on the magazine cover and was featured in a few movies. Was fame a concern for him? Not at all. But he somehow picked up the attention w***e attitude. :-)

THE LAST DAYS
Although I could tell he was ready to depart since his eyes had been a little bit gloomy over the past month, there was something more in them. Although I'm not the greatest interpreter of dog eyes, I could figure out the following from his gaze: "Talk to me." So we talked about our lives together every evening for the past couple of weeks while I sat down next to him. The best psychotherapy that would make Sigmund Freud jealous. We talk about some beautiful chapters, some really s**tty ones in our lives. For example, do you recall Pablo, the mother fu**er who vomited on Frida Kahlo? I used to have lovely and always nicely smelling Frida Kahlo's pillows at the bar. Although we spoke a lot, he became weaker every evening. And the last evening he just gave me a long arrivederci good bey look, closed his eyes and he was gone. Just like that. I'm grieving a happy sadness. Like smiles through tears and tears through smiles. This is a good vital grief, but nonetheless, anyone who lived through this will understand completely. Dogs are not our whole life, but they make our lives whole.

THANKS FOR READING!

Martin

PS: Jela Krivanova is a lovely woman who took Pablo in as a puppy when he lived next to the garbage can and took him into her home. I later adopted him. So thank you again for saving this angel and the tiny devil as well :-) since he brought so many loving memories into my life. And that is what really matters. I'm sure I'll run across him again. Officially, we closed our club this month. We got a slap in the face by a Covid hysteria, but still smiling and alive. The journey was tough since March last year. F**k the money we didn't make but it's hard to replace the passion, love and freedom we have created in our place. And our amazing guests. We still believe that whatever is done with love is done well.❤️ We might reopen somewhere else, but not this year. In any case, thank you to everyone who loves The Bourgeois Pig in Prague. We love you too and you are missed terribly. ❤️ And BIG thank you to our lovely bartenders Marian, Alex, Nikita, Marek and many more guys. See ya in better times✌️Martin

We're happy that we sold today our over 100 years old piano (for a symbolic price of 40 EUR) to Elizabeth from Ukraine who was a former piano teacher back home. She lives in Prague now and working as a cook to make some living. She was missing her piano terribly. So Bon Voyage our black queen. Your deep sound of your heartbeat was, is and will be always in our heart. We baptised you by the 55 % holy water H2OMG 😜 called Sliwovitz and gave you a promise to stay with us forever, but you know s**t happens. So at least you're in a beautiful hands now and can help that lovely woman to become a piano teacher again in Prague. Thanks for all those beautiful nights! 🙏 Do prdele!😜
